Harrisburg Light Parade - December 3, 2022
The Harrisburg Light Parade, Saturday, December 3, 2022!
This years theme is 'The Polar Express'! The Tri-County Chamber of Commerce holds the light parade on Friday night, December 2nd, in Junction City, and on Saturday night, December 3rd, in Harrisburg. Monroe's parade will be held on Saturday, December 10th. All parades begin at 7pm.
The Parade Route starts at the high school, continues north on 9th St., turns left onto Territorial, then south onto N. 3rd St. (Hwy 99) and then east on Smith St. to return to the high school.
Before the parade: The Senior Center, located at 354 Smith St, will be holding a Holiday Bazaar from 10am to 4pm. Crafts-Baked Goods-Coffee-Hot Cider-Donuts-Water-Books and Gently Used Decor for sale! All proceeds benefit the Senior Center!
Following the parade: Please join us for a Holiday Gathering held at Heritage Park located at 490 Smith Street (Museum). Join Santa Claus and Mrs. Claus for some free cookies and hot apple cider from Detering Orchards. Santa's helpers will also hand out candy bags and apples to children visiting!
